Step 1: Understanding the Metric and Imperial Systems
Before we begin, it's essential to have a basic understanding of the two measurement systems we're dealing with: the metric system (commonly used in most countries) and the imperial system (predominantly used in the United States and a few other countries). The metric system is based on units of 10, making conversions relatively straightforward. On the other hand, the imperial system uses a variety of units, including inches, feet, and yards.
Step 2: Defining the Conversion Factor
The key to converting between units is understanding the conversion factor. For centimeters to inches, the conversion factor is simple: 1 inch is approximately equal to 2.54 centimeters. This means that to convert centimeters to inches, you divide the centimeter value by 2.54.
Step 3: Performing the Conversion
Now, let's apply this conversion factor to our specific example. We want to convert 10 centimeters to inches. Here's the calculation:
10 centimeters / 2.54 centimeters per inch = approximately 3.94 inches
Step 4: Interpreting the Result
The result of our conversion is approximately 3.94 inches. This means that an object measuring 10 centimeters in length would be just under 4 inches long if measured in the imperial system. It's important to note that while we get a decimal value, most measurements are rounded to the nearest whole number or to a specific decimal place, depending on the level of precision required.

Can I perform the reverse conversion (from inches to centimeters) using the same method?
+Yes, the same principle applies for the reverse conversion. You would simply multiply the inch value by the conversion factor (2.54) to get the equivalent length in centimeters.
